Bureau Bijzondere Opdrachten
The Bureau Bijzondere Opdrachten (BBO, "Office of Special Assignments") was a Dutch secret service during World War II. The BBO dispatched secret agents to the German-occupied Netherlands, where they supported the local resistance and carried out sabotage activities.
